Stop TB Partnership launches call for nominations for the Community Award 2024

NEWS ALERT 19 June 2024 | Geneva, Switzerland

GENEVA, Switzerland - The Stop TB Partnership is launching the call for nominations for the STP Community Award 2024 under the theme “Ending TB Stigma through Art”.

While art forms have played a central role in conveying messages for centuries, for the first time ever the Stop TB Partnership is looking to utilize the potential of diverse and dynamic artistic forms to capture a message to End TB stigma.

Over the last five years, the Stop TB Partnership has conferred this annual prize for excellence in advancing an equitable, rights-based, stigma-free and gender-sensitive TB response. The prize is specifically aimed at the efforts of grassroots, advocacy and engagement initiatives from TB high-burden countries. Stop TB Partnership is pleased to again partner with Humana People to People Foundation for the 2024 award.

THEME

This year the theme of the award is “Ending TB Stigma through Art” and therefore submissions for the 2024 award must be:

  • Visual Arts: paintings, sculptures, drawings, photography, film, cartoon, installations and other visual art forms
  • Literary Arts: short story, play, or poem
  • Performing Arts: original musical compositions, songs or theatrical performances (e.g. spoken word, dance etc.)
  • Social Media Art: Reels, brief innovative videos for different social media platforms

Submissions may choose to engage and/or cross traditional and modern platforms and artistic mediums.

SELECTION PROCESS


All nominations will be reviewed by the selection panel. The scoring will be based on:

  • Demonstrated purpose and a focus on TB stigma and Ending TB stigma 
  • Creativity and innovation in presenting an End TB stigma message
  • Technique and craftsmanship in development the nominated submission
  • Significance and impact pertaining to Ending TB stigma made by the nominated submission

FINAL DECISION AND THE WINNERS


The winner(s) will be announced in December 2024 during the Stop TB Board meeting in Nigeria.
